X-Git-Url: https://www.chiark.greenend.org.uk/ucgi/~ianmdlvl/git?a=blobdiff_plain;f=Makefile.am;h=6be64070f4c63a70bab8d612af0cc667e143ef8c;hb=82bdf8ce36ccfe1b6ff389a9c9c7e2b2d049a43d;hp=eaf6c6317ec7fdc18562d6552cfd0160d56dc901;hpb=911f4d4d60eae3cfa5b8ca122169f3ca21da4afc;p=elogind.git diff --git a/Makefile.am b/Makefile.am index eaf6c6317..6be64070f 100644 --- a/Makefile.am +++ b/Makefile.am @@ -196,6 +196,7 @@ AM_CPPFLAGS = \ -I $(top_srcdir)/src/libsystemd/sd-bus \ -I $(top_srcdir)/src/libsystemd/sd-event \ -I $(top_srcdir)/src/libsystemd/sd-rtnl \ + -I $(top_srcdir)/src/libsystemd-network \ $(OUR_CPPFLAGS) AM_CFLAGS = $(OUR_CFLAGS) @@ -502,9 +503,6 @@ EXTRA_DIST += \ units/systemd-fsck@.service.in \ units/systemd-fsck-root.service.in \ units/user@.service.in \ - units/systemd-udevd.service \ - units/systemd-udev-trigger.service \ - units/systemd-udev-settle.service \ units/debug-shell.service.in \ units/systemd-hibernate.service.in \ units/systemd-hybrid-sleep.service.in \ @@ -2401,41 +2399,44 @@ busctl_CFLAGS = \ # ------------------------------------------------------------------------------ noinst_LTLIBRARIES += \ - libsystemd-dhcp.la + libsystemd-network.la -libsystemd_dhcp_la_SOURCES = \ +libsystemd_network_la_SOURCES = \ + src/systemd/sd-network.h \ src/systemd/sd-dhcp-client.h \ - src/libsystemd-dhcp/sd-dhcp-client.c \ - src/libsystemd-dhcp/dhcp-lease.h \ - src/libsystemd-dhcp/dhcp-lease.c \ - src/libsystemd-dhcp/dhcp-network.c \ - src/libsystemd-dhcp/dhcp-option.c \ - src/libsystemd-dhcp/dhcp-packet.c \ - src/libsystemd-dhcp/dhcp-internal.h \ - src/libsystemd-dhcp/dhcp-protocol.h - -libsystemd_dhcp_la_LIBADD = \ + src/systemd/sd-dhcp-lease.h \ + src/network/sd-network.c \ + src/libsystemd-network/sd-dhcp-client.c \ + src/libsystemd-network/dhcp-network.c \ + src/libsystemd-network/dhcp-option.c \ + src/libsystemd-network/dhcp-packet.c \ + src/libsystemd-network/dhcp-internal.h \ + src/libsystemd-network/dhcp-protocol.h \ + src/libsystemd-network/dhcp-lease-internal.h \ + src/libsystemd-network/sd-dhcp-lease.c + +libsystemd_network_la_LIBADD = \ libsystemd-internal.la \ libsystemd-shared.la test_dhcp_option_SOURCES = \ - src/libsystemd-dhcp/dhcp-protocol.h \ - src/libsystemd-dhcp/dhcp-internal.h \ - src/libsystemd-dhcp/test-dhcp-option.c + src/libsystemd-network/dhcp-protocol.h \ + src/libsystemd-network/dhcp-internal.h \ + src/libsystemd-network/test-dhcp-option.c test_dhcp_option_LDADD = \ - libsystemd-dhcp.la \ + libsystemd-network.la \ libsystemd-internal.la \ libsystemd-shared.la test_dhcp_client_SOURCES = \ src/systemd/sd-dhcp-client.h \ - src/libsystemd-dhcp/dhcp-protocol.h \ - src/libsystemd-dhcp/dhcp-internal.h \ - src/libsystemd-dhcp/test-dhcp-client.c + src/libsystemd-network/dhcp-protocol.h \ + src/libsystemd-network/dhcp-internal.h \ + src/libsystemd-network/test-dhcp-client.c test_dhcp_client_LDADD = \ - libsystemd-dhcp.la \ + libsystemd-network.la \ libsystemd-internal.la \ libsystemd-shared.la @@ -4036,7 +4037,7 @@ nodist_libsystemd_networkd_core_la_SOURCES = \ libsystemd_networkd_core_la_LIBADD = \ libudev-internal.la \ libsystemd-internal.la \ - libsystemd-dhcp.la \ + libsystemd-network.la \ libsystemd-label.la \ libsystemd-shared.la @@ -4046,6 +4047,16 @@ nodist_systemunit_DATA += \ GENERAL_ALIASES += \ $(systemunitdir)/systemd-networkd.service $(pkgsysconfdir)/system/multi-user.target.wants/systemd-networkd.service +rootlibexec_PROGRAMS += \ + systemd-networkd-wait-online + +systemd_networkd_wait_online_SOURCES = \ + src/network/networkd-wait-online.c + +systemd_networkd_wait_online_LDADD = \ + libsystemd-internal.la \ + libsystemd-network.la + test_network_SOURCES = \ src/network/test-network.c